| Description |
The Loews House of Blues Hotel combines a fun, rock-n- roll ambiance with high levels of service and un- pretentious luxury. This unique Chicago hotel was designed using Gothic, Moroccan, Indian and American Folk Art motifs reflective of the legendary House of Blues Club and Restaurant also located within the Marina City Complex. Two additional restaurants, Smith & Wollensky Steakhouse and BIN 36 Wine Bar and Restaurant, plus a fully-equipped, fitness facility round out the complex. Located on the Chicago River just steps away from world-class shopping on State Street and Michigan Ave. plus Chicago's newly rejuvenated Theatre District, The Loews House of Blues Hotel provides a perfect respite for both the business traveler who's tired of the ordinary or for the adventurous weekend traveler! The well appointed guest rooms features many amenities to make the enviroment a home away from home experience. The rooms features a In-room fax machine; In-house movies and all equipped with handicap accessible. The Loews House of Blues also features cabin rooms. The cabin rooms are quaint European sized rooms located on the lower floors of the hotel and offers all of the amenities and luxury of the standard guest rooms. The cabin rooms are approximately 250 square feet and offer one queen-sized bed. |

| Driving Directions |
From O'Hare International Airport: Take the I-190 East ramp towards Chicago Loop. Merge onto I-190 E. Take I-90 E/Kennedy Expressway E. Take I-90 E/Kennedy Expressway E/I-94 E. Take the East Washington Blvd./100 North exit, exit number 51C. Turn left onto W Washington Blvd. Turn left onto N Upper Wacker Dr. Turn left onto N Dearborn St.
